To understand what makes a digitally surfaced lens far superior, let’s take a closer look at the difference between traditionally surfaced lenses and digitally surfaced lenses.
Traditionally Surfaced Lenses
Traditionally surfaced lenses are created with a hands-on approach that is very laborious and time-consuming. Lab technicians are in charge of making sure the materials they select for your lenses match your prescription. The lenses have to be laid out, marked, and blocked all before they can be processed. Once the surfaces have been generated, the lab tech must choose from among hundreds of pre-made tools before they are fined and polished. If all goes right, these tools get the Rx within 1/10 of a diopter of the actual prescription. Then the lenses have a scratch-resistant hard coating added to the back surface that is UV cured.
Digitally Surfaced Lenses
In contrast, digitally surfaced lenses are high-definition lenses that are created with state-of-the-art equipment, using a diamond-point lathe cutter controlled by computer software. The prescription is carved into the back of the lens blank. Your lenses can be created specifically for your vision needs and the lab doesn’t have to use a pre-made lens to start with, nor are premade tools used to polish the lenses so they are polished within 1/100th of a diopter of your actual prescription, 10 times more accurate than conventional lenses.
In addition, digitally surfaced lenses can be created for just about anyone who wears glasses, no matter if they need single vision or progressive lenses. The lenses can be created from thin and light materials, which means more comfort for all-day wear. They can also receive non-glare treatments, tints, and they can adjust to changes in lighting conditions with photochromic technology. These lenses will be sharper and will provide a larger field of view than traditionally surfaced lenses.
